The Poisons Act 1979 regulates the sale or supply of non-medicinal poisons, a list of these substances is contained within the Act.
The Poisons List is divided into two parts, Part 1 contains substances which in general can only be sold for retail pharmacy premises by a pharmacist e.g. arsenic, cyanide.
Part 2 of the List contains substances, which can be sold by persons who are registered under the Act e.g. Sodium Hydroxide, Paraquat.
